The Producer Responsibility Obligations (Packaging Waste) Regulations were introduced in 1997 with the aim of reducing the amount of packaging waste ending up in landfill.
Who is Affected?
- Your business has a packaging obligation if ALL of the following points apply to you:
- Your annual UK turnover exceeds £2 million, AND You perform a relevant activity on any of the packaging you handle, AND
- You own the packaging or packaging materials that you handle, AND You handle more than 50 tonnes of packaging and/or packaging materials

Other things you should be aware of:
- Your organisation can be obligated if it is part of a group that collectively exceeds the thresholds outlined above, even if it doesn’t meet the thresholds on its own
- Northern Ireland has its own Packaging Waste Regulations which means that organisations with operations in Northern Ireland will need to register these separately with the Northern Ireland Environment Agency
What Do You Need to Do?
Obligated organisations must:
- Register with the appropriate environment agency. This can be done either directly with the environment agency or you can join Valpak
- Complete an annual data submission detailing the amount of packaging they have handled
- Calculate their obligation i.e. how much packaging waste they must pay towards getting recycled, use our Packaging Obligation Calculator
- Meet their obligation by procuring recycling evidence notes known as PRNs (packaging waste recovery notes)
- Provide recycling information to consumers if they supply packaging to end users (Consumer Information Obligations)

How Much Does it Cost?
There are three sets of fees that you will need to pay in order to become compliant with the regulations:
- Agency fees – everyone has to pay a set environment agency registration fee each year
- Annual Membership fee – this covers our administration costs of checking and verifying your data
- PRN fees – this is the cost of procuring recycling evidence notes needed to meet your obligation
